Summary
Encounters with cannibals, convicts, and pirates were just some of the highlights of eleven long journeys under sail Captain George Bayly made around the world in the early nineteenth century.
The journal Captain Bayly kept of his travels is notable for the historical significance of his voyages and the writer’s eye for a good story. It contains eyewitness accounts of the transportation of male and female convicts to Australia, the voyage of British immigrants to the ill-fated settlem…
